Potential Reasons for Clicking
A clicking sound during a jump-start attempt typically indicates a failure in the electrical pathway between the donor vehicle and the recipient vehicle. This failure can stem from various sources, each with its own set of symptoms. The following list Artikels the most common culprits:
- Dead Battery: A dead or failing battery is the most frequent cause of a clicking sound. The battery’s inability to supply enough current to the starter motor results in a clicking sound rather than the smooth cranking action. Symptoms often include dim headlights, a sluggish radio response, and an overall lack of power in the car. A weak battery, while still technically functioning, can produce the same result.
- Faulty Starter Motor: The starter motor, responsible for initiating the engine’s rotation, can malfunction, causing a clicking sound instead of the expected whirring. The clicking may be intermittent, occurring only under certain conditions. This often accompanies other issues, such as a complete lack of engine rotation or difficult starting even without a jump start.
- Damaged or Corroded Cables: Loose, corroded, or damaged jumper cables can disrupt the flow of electricity. Corrosion on the terminals of the battery or the connections within the starter motor can also be a source of the clicking sound. These issues may lead to intermittent clicking or complete failure of the jump start.
- Malfunctioning Starter Relay: The starter relay switches the power to the starter motor. A faulty relay can cause clicking instead of energizing the starter motor, leading to the same symptom of a no-start situation. This can manifest in intermittent clicking or a complete lack of response. The relay may need replacement or repair.
- Electrical System Problems: Hidden electrical issues in the car’s system, such as a blown fuse, a short circuit, or a damaged wiring harness, can also disrupt the jump-start process, leading to the clicking sound. These are often more complex issues that might necessitate professional diagnostics.

Electrical System Components
Your car’s starting system is a marvel of interconnected parts, each playing a crucial role in getting your engine roaring to life. Understanding these components is key to deciphering the clicking sound that sometimes accompanies a jump-start attempt. Let’s delve into the essential players.
Starter Motor
The starter motor is the workhorse of the starting system. It’s a small electric motor designed to crank the engine until it catches. Think of it as a powerful electric drill, rapidly turning the engine’s crankshaft. This spinning action gets the engine moving, starting the combustion process.
Solenoid
The solenoid is a crucial relay in the system. It’s an electromagnet that engages the starter motor. When you turn the ignition key, the solenoid receives a signal, creating a magnetic field that activates the starter motor. It’s like the switch that connects the starter motor to the battery’s power.
Ignition Switch
The ignition switch acts as the central control hub. It regulates the flow of electricity to various components in the car, including the starter motor. Different positions of the ignition key activate different circuits, directing power to the appropriate parts for starting, running, or other operations. This switch controls the electrical pathway, ensuring the correct sequence of events.
The Clicking Sound and Faulty Components
A clicking sound during a jump-start attempt often points to a problem with the solenoid or the starter motor itself. A malfunctioning solenoid might click but fail to fully engage the starter motor, preventing it from turning over. Similarly, a failing starter motor might produce a clicking noise, as the electrical system tries to activate it, but the motor itself is unable to crank the engine due to internal issues.
A weak or failing battery can also contribute to this problem. The connection between these components and the sound is direct: a hiccup in any of these links interrupts the proper electrical flow, resulting in the telltale clicking noise.
Electrical Pathway During Jump-Start
To understand the clicking sound, consider the electrical pathway during a jump-start. This involves a flow of current from the donor vehicle’s battery through the jumper cables, to the receiving vehicle’s battery. The ignition switch, when turned to the start position, initiates a signal to the solenoid. The solenoid, upon receiving this signal, activates the starter motor. If there’s a breakdown anywhere along this route, a clicking sound might arise.

Comparing a Healthy and Faulty Battery
The difference between a healthy and faulty battery can be subtle but critical.
Feature | Healthy Battery | Faulty Battery |
---|---|---|
Appearance | Visually sound, no visible dents or bulges, terminals are clean and tight | Potentially swollen, dented, corroded terminals, or loose connections |
Starting Sound | Robust, consistent cranking sound | Clicking sound, weak or intermittent cranking |
Voltage | Consistent voltage (typically 12.6V or higher when fully charged) | Low voltage, fluctuating voltage, or voltage drops during cranking |
Charge Retention | Maintains charge well over time | Loses charge quickly, even when not in use |
